Recent versions of bhyve support 4 com ports instead of just 2. Thus,
allow to use 4 console devices.
Also, there was a bug previously because the condition was
"if (chr->target.port > 2)", but as target.port start
with 0 and "com" ports start with 1, this condition allows com3 to be
used.
As bhyve supports 4 com ports already long enough, and all supported
FreeBSD versions include this capability, do not introduce driver
capability for that.
Add a couple of tests for that:
- A domain that uses 4 serials, 2 of type 'nmdm'
and the other 2 of type 'tcp'
- A domain that uses unsupported port, such as target.port=4 which
translates into com5.
